Photoshop Generative Fill: A Powerful AI Photo Editor
When you think of editing photos, Photoshop is likely the first tool that comes to mind. It’s one of the most popular photo editors, and now it has an amazing feature called Generative Fill, powered by Adobe’s Firefly AI.
If you’ve used Photoshop before, you might know about Content-Aware Fill, which helps you remove objects from photos. Generative Fill takes this further, allowing you to not only remove objects with more precision but also add new ones, change backgrounds, and make other major edits easily. The AI blends everything seamlessly, making your edits look natural.
What makes Generative Fill really special is that you can type in a simple text prompt to tell Photoshop’s AI exactly what changes you want. For example, you can ask it to add a tree, remove a person, or replace the sky—all with just a few words. Compared to Google Photos’ Magic Eraser, Generative Fill offers better results and more control.
If you already have an Adobe Creative Cloud subscription, you get access to Generative Fill without paying extra. However, there is a monthly limit on how many edits you can make, depending on your subscription plan.
Overall, if you want a powerful, easy-to-use AI tool for editing photos, Photoshop’s Generative Fill is one of the best options out there.
Luminar Neo: A Simple and Powerful Photo Editor with AI
Luminar Neo is a great option if you’re looking for a photo editor that’s easy to use but still powerful. While Photoshop is well-known for its advanced editing tools, it can be difficult for beginners. Luminar Neo, on the other hand, offers many of the same features but with a simpler, more user-friendly design.
With Luminar Neo, you get several AI-powered tools that make editing photos faster and easier:
- Relight AI: Brightens dark areas in your photos, revealing more details.
- Background Removal: Easily removes unwanted backgrounds from photos with just a few clicks.
- Portrait Bokeh: Adds a nice blur to backgrounds, giving your portraits a professional look.
- AI Cropping Tool: Helps you find the best crop for your images for better composition.
Although Luminar Neo doesn’t have the same organizing features as Adobe products, it focuses on making photo editing simple and intuitive.
Soon, Luminar Neo will also get new AI features like the ability to expand images, add objects, and replace skies—making it even more powerful.
If you want an easy-to-use photo editor with smart AI tools, Luminar Neo is a fantastic choice. It’s perfect for anyone who wants high-quality photo edits without the complexity of more advanced software.
Midjourney and DALL-E 3: Easy AI Tools for Creative Photo Editing
If you want to completely change or remix your photos, Midjourney and DALL-E 3 are great options. They aren’t traditional photo editors, but they are powerful AI tools that turn text into images. Plus, they have editing features that let you change existing pictures.
- Inpainting lets you edit parts of an image, like replacing or removing objects.
- Outpainting allows you to extend the image, adding new elements beyond its original size.
For example, I asked DALL-E to replace a vacuum tube in a picture with a vase, and it made the change based on my instructions. The result wasn’t perfect, but it’s a creative way to edit photos.
While Midjourney and DALL-E 3 can produce amazing results, they don’t have simple interfaces like regular photo editors. You might need to follow some guides to get the hang of it.
If you want to experiment with AI and make creative edits to your photos, Midjourney and DALL-E 3 are fun tools to try. Just be prepared to learn a little before you start using them!

Topaz Photo AI: A Simple AI Tool to Enhance Your Photos
Topaz Photo AI is an easy-to-use photo editing tool that focuses on improving the quality of your images using AI technology. While it doesn’t have as many features as other editors, it’s perfect for enhancing photos without making big changes.
Topaz is also known for tools like Gigapixel AI, which can enlarge images without losing quality. Topaz Photo AI offers a few key features:
- Upscaling: Enlarge photos while keeping them sharp and clear.
- Denoising: Removes grainy noise to make your images smoother.
- Sharpening: Helps make moving objects clearer and more detailed.
Unlike complex editors like Lightroom, Topaz Photo AI is great for quick touch-ups. It’s ideal if you want to improve photo quality without needing to learn lots of features. Soon, Topaz Photo AI will also include the option to remove objects from images, making it even more useful.
Topaz Photo AI is perfect for enhancing photos—whether you want to sharpen, upscale, or reduce noise. It’s simple, effective and great for photographers who want high-quality results with minimal effort.
